/** * Removes a timeout from the timeout list, invoking the * application's DBusRemoveTimeoutFunction if appropriate. * * @param timeout_list the timeout list. * @param timeout the timeout to remove. */ void _dbus_timeout_list_remove_timeout (DBusTimeoutList *timeout_list, DBusTimeout *timeout) { if (!_dbus_list_remove (&timeout_list->timeouts, timeout)) _dbus_assert_not_reached ("Nonexistent timeout was removed"); if (timeout_list->remove_timeout_function != NULL) (* timeout_list->remove_timeout_function) (timeout, timeout_list->timeout_data); _dbus_timeout_unref (timeout); }

/** * Adds a new timeout to the timeout list, invoking the * application DBusAddTimeoutFunction if appropriate. * * @param timeout_list the timeout list. * @param timeout the timeout to add. * @returns #TRUE on success, #FALSE If no memory. */ dbus_bool_t _dbus_timeout_list_add_timeout (DBusTimeoutList *timeout_list, DBusTimeout *timeout) { if (!_dbus_list_append (&timeout_list->timeouts, timeout)) return FALSE; _dbus_timeout_ref (timeout); if (timeout_list->add_timeout_function != NULL) { if (!(* timeout_list->add_timeout_function) (timeout, timeout_list->timeout_data)) { _dbus_list_remove_last (&timeout_list->timeouts, timeout); _dbus_timeout_unref (timeout); return FALSE; } } return TRUE; }
